  • I think there is a big problem with the new Ryanair beta website. I have tracked flights to various destinations on the old site and they used to change prices every Tuesday from 11am, prices would go up or down depending on what month it was and when you were travelling. If travelling in May then flight prices tended to be cheap from around the end of November to the end of February before rising sharply. They then fell during a couple of weeks in April before going sharply up again. I think they used to track other companies flights to the same destinations and price accordingly. The new beta site does not appear to do this at this time, whether it will do after they sort it out I dont know (I cannot use the new website using an Android smartphone or tablet, and only certain computers I use can log into the new site successfully for a brief time).

    You might be better playing with the system as you might find 2 would be on reduced price as it often goes up for different numbers. You also might be better booking the flights seperately as for the return you'll pay euros, which even with the fee for a credit card if you pay on a halifax card you'll get the better exchange rate so it will be a lot cheaper.
